About the Role
As an Associate Program Manager, you will support the successful execution of client programs by managing timelines, workflows, and project deliverables. Working under the guidance of a Program Director or Program Manager, you will act as a central point of coordination across internal teams, clients, and external partners.
In your day-to-day, you will oversee project workflows, facilitate internal and client meetings, and ensure that deliverables progress on schedule. You will also help manage medical/legal/regulatory (MLR) submissions, coordinate with vendors, and support financial tracking, including budgets and invoicing. Additionally, you will have the opportunity to independently lead smaller projects while mentoring junior team members and contributing to overall team success.
